Sony’s Xperia 1 IV has been in the news for a while now, however, the phone’s launch date wasn’t confirmed. Now, Sony has officially announced a launch event this month where we are expected to see the flagship Sony Xperia 1 IV.

Sony has shared a teaser video confirming that the brand will be holding a launch on May 11 at 4 PM Japan time (12:30 PM IST/7 AM UTC). While the company hasn’t explicitly mentioned the exact product it’s going to release at the event, the teaser video does hint at a flagship Xperia phone.

This flagship phone to arrive is most likely the Sony Xperia 1 IV. Just like previous iterations, the Xperia 1 IV is also expected to offer premium specifications.

The smartphone passed the Geekbench certification recently and it scored 1204 points in the single-core department and 3352 points in the multi-core department. It has the model number XQ-CT54 and is pow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 chipset. It has 12GB of RAM and has Android 12 OS.

While the design is yet to be officially confirmed, the phone’s concept renders were surfaced by LetsGoDigital. The device is tipped to feature a 6.5-inch display with a 21:9 aspect ratio. It is expected to come with a 120Hz refresh rate and 4K resolution. It will have Gorilla Glass Victus protection and HDR support.

As for the optics, the phone is said to come with ZEISS branded sensors. It is expected to have a triple camera system with the inclusion of ultra-wide and telephoto sensors. The phone is expected to come with a side-facing fingerprint scanner and pack a 5,000mAh battery with 45W fast charging support.
